Overview
The IRWIN 2078110 is priced at $13.99, the lowest price of any product in this Tongue-and-Groove Pliers list. It carries a 4.6-star rating from 2,700 reviews, with 400 buyers in the last month, the second-highest recent buyer count in this batch.
The listing specifies a metal handle and an item weight of 0.13 kilograms, making it one of the lighter pliers here despite its all-metal construction.
At this price point, 2,700 reviews and 400 monthly buyers is a strong demand signal, even though its 4.6-star average is the lowest rating in this batch, still well above our 3.8-star floor.
